Asendia UK is seeking a motivated Junior to Mid‑Level Developer to join our IT team on a fixed‑term basis. This role sits within a fast‑paced eCommerce logistics environment and will contribute to the development, maintenance, and enhancement of our multi‑application full‑stack platform, supporting the full logistics lifecycle from order capture through to last‑mile delivery. The successful candidate will support day‑to‑day operational needs, including handling support tickets and routine configurations to help reduce the current backlog. In addition, the role will play an important part in progressing key technical debt and security initiatives, such as server upgrades and application migrations. You will also contribute to the design, build, and maintenance of core UK systems that underpin our operational processes.
Key Responsibilities
- Develop and maintain features across full‑stack web applications using modern frameworks
- Produce clean, well‑tested, and well‑documented code aligned with team standards
- Collaborate with Business Analysts and Test Analysts to translate requirements into technical solutions
- Participate in code reviews and provide constructive feedback
- Investigate and resolve bugs across development, staging, and production environments
- Support integrations with third‑party logistics APIs, carrier systems, and warehouse management tools
- Adopt new technologies and frameworks as the platform evolves
Technical Skills & Experience
- Proficiency in at least one backend language and associated frameworks (e.g., C#, PHP)
- Familiarity with RESTful APIs, microservices, and integration patterns
- Working knowledge of relational databases (e.g., TSQL) and intermediate SQL
- Understanding of software development lifecycle (SDLC) principles
- Experience with automated testing and unit testing
- Exposure to DevOps tools (e.g., Jenkins) and source control (Git/BitBucket)
- Experience with cloud platforms such as GCP, AWS, or Azure
- Exposure to Windows Server, IIS, and related services
- Understanding of logistics, warehousing, or supply chain concepts
Fixed Deliverables During the Contract
- Enhancement of ASUK back‑office software, including delivery of new UIs and functionality to streamline common tasks
- Simplification of customer onboarding processes
- Expansion and maintenance of technical documentation
- Reduction of technical debt through migration of legacy platforms and applications
- Enhancement of automated testing coverage to improve software quality, reliability, and deployment confidence.
